**Savills Brokers Nearly 10,000-Square-Foot Dual Office Lease in Virginia**
Savills has successfully brokered two office leases totaling nearly 10,000 square feet at 2600 Park Tower Drive, also known as Metro Place II, located in Merrifield, Virginia. The leases were signed on behalf of U.S. subsidiaries of Rheinmetall, a global defense and technology group.
American Rheinmetall Defense has secured a 3,486-square-foot space, while American Rheinmetall Munitions—one of the company’s specialized operating divisions—will occupy 6,000 square feet on a separate floor within the building.
The long-term leases at the Metro Place II tower, owned by COPT Defense Properties, underscore Rheinmetall’s rapid expansion in the United States. This growth reflects the company’s commitment to investing in its domestic industrial footprint, enhancing engineering capabilities, and increasing its American workforce.
Ken Biberaj, Executive Managing Director, and Nick DiChiara, Managing Director at Savills, represented Rheinmetall in the lease transactions. Cushman & Wakefield represented the landlord, COPT Defense Properties.
Metro Place II is a Class-A, nearly 250,000-square-foot office building constructed in 1999. The property features 950 on-site parking spaces, a tenant-exclusive conference facility, a lounge, a fitness center, and is conveniently located near the Dunn Loring-Merrifield Metro station.
